引言
TPWallet 流动池(liquidity pool)是为去中心化交易、跨链桥和即时支付提供流动性的关键组件。本文从架构、实时交易分析、信息化技术演进、余额查询机制、全球科技支付场景、哈希碰撞风险与系统防护策略等角度,给出系统化的分析与实践建议。
一、流动池架构与角色
流动池通常由资金提供者(LP)、交易消费者(用户或路由器)、清算器与治理合约构成。实现形式可基于AMM(自动做市商)、订单簿或集中式撮合。TPWallet 可采用混合架构:链上AMM保证去信任化结算,链下撮合与聚合器优化执行价格与延迟。
二、实时交易分析(关键要点)
1. 数据来源:链上事件(Transfer、Swap)、RPC节点、区块浏览器API、历史索引器(The Graph)、区块链监听服务。链下则包括网关日志、API 网关、交易路由器日志和支付网关回执。
2. 指标监控:TPS、确认时间、滑点、深度、挂单簿/AMM池深度、资金池余额、前端延迟、拒单率。
3. 分析技术:流处理(Kafka/Fluentd + Flink/Storm)、时间序列数据库(Prometheus、InfluxDB)、实时风控规则引擎与机器学习模型(异常检测、价格操纵识别)。
4. 可视化与告警:实时看板、SLO/SLA 指标、异常回滚策略与人工干预流程。
三、信息化科技发展对流动池的影响
1. 区块链底层演进(更快共识、分片、L2 扩容)降低结算延迟与手续费,提升流动性利用率。
2. 云原生与边缘计算提高高并发吞吐与就近验证能力,结合服务网格(Istio)实现可观测性与流量治理。

3. AI/ML 在策略路由、动态费率定价与异常检测中的应用,提升资本效率与安全性。
四、余额查询(准确性与性能)
1. 查询策略:直接RPC调用保证强一致性,但延迟高;使用索引器或缓存(Redis、CDN)可实现高并发低延迟查询。
2. 缓存失效策略:基于事件订阅(链上事件驱动更新)和乐观并发控制,保证最终一致性同时避免脏读。
3. 权限与隐私:对外提供聚合余额与授权视图,敏感账户数据需做脱敏或基于零知识证明的隐私查询。
五、全球科技支付场景
1. 跨境结算:结合稳定币、原子交换与桥接协议实现近实时清算,考虑地域合规与KYC/AML。
2. 本地化接入:支持法币通道与本地支付网关(ACH、SEPA、快速支付),提供多链、多通证路由。
3. 互操作性策略:采用跨链中继、IBC、通用交换协议(如Wormhole、Hop)降低桥接失败率并提高资金可用性。
六、哈希碰撞风险与应对
1. 风险概述:哈希函数若发生碰撞,可能导致身份、交易或证明被错误接受,但现代加密哈希(SHA-256、Keccak-256)在现实中能把碰撞概率降到可忽略。
2. 防护措施:使用强哈希算法、增加域分隔(domain separation)、结合公钥签名验证而非仅依赖哈希。对长期安全性考虑,规划可插拔哈希算法以支持未来迁移。
七、系统防护与安全运维
1. 智能合约安全:形式化验证、表述性测试、审计、时间锁、多签治理与升级流程。
2. 基础设施防护:DDoS 保护、WAF、速率限制、身份认证(mTLS)、私钥与秘钥管理(HSM、KMS)、分层备份。

3. 实时风控:交易限额、反洗钱规则、异常行为模型(机器学习)、回滚与冷却期策略。
4. 应急响应:演练、SLA 分级告警、链上事件快速回滚/隔离机制、用户赔付与透明披露流程。
结论与建议
TPWallet 流动池系统需在性能、成本与安全之间找到平衡。建议分阶段部署:先保障链上结算与关键路径的可验证性,再通过链下聚合与智能路由优化延迟与费用;全面引入实时监控与AI 风控;对哈希与加密依赖定期评估并准备迁移方案;建立完整的运维与应急体系以保护用户资产与系统可用性。
评论
LiWei
很全面的技术路线,特别赞同链上+链下混合架构的建议。
Sakura
关于哈希碰撞部分讲得很好,补充一点量子抗性哈希也值得关注。
链小白
能不能写个实现示例或架构图?读起来很有帮助。
Dev_86
实时风控那段很实用,想知道你推荐哪些ML模型用于异常检测?
TechNoir
余额查询的缓存失效策略描述很务实,企业级实现中非常必要。
张珊
希望后续能出一篇关于多链桥容错与回滚机制的深度文章。